Bumrah returns as Harshit Rana ruled out of Afghanistan T20Is with injury

0
·5 views

Jasprit Bumrah has been declared fit and will be part of India's squad for the upcoming T20I series against Afghanistan and the Asian Games. Harshit Rana, however, has been ruled out after sustaining a new injury during a match simulation session on September 7 at the Centre of Excellence in Bengaluru. Yash Thakur has been named as his replacement in the squad. The injury setback is a blow for Rana, who had been included in the original selection.

Shafali and Deepti star as India beat Bangladesh to reach Asia Cup final

India secured a comfortable victory over Bangladesh in Dubai to advance into their 10th Asia Cup final. Shafali Verma and Deepti Sharma were the standout performers, powering India's strong showing in the semifinal. Both teams struggled with their fielding standards throughout the match. Despite the sloppy fielding on display, India's batting and bowling proved decisive enough to seal the win.

Bhatia fifty and Ramharack's three-wicket haul seal easy TKR win over Empress

Trinbago Knight Riders secured a comfortable victory against Empress in a recent T20 fixture. Knight Riders' bowlers put in a disciplined performance, restricting Empress to just 100 runs. Ramharack was the standout with the ball, claiming three wickets to anchor the bowling effort. In the chase, Bhatia contributed a half-century while Dottin provided strong support to guide TKR home. The target was reached with 53 balls to spare, underscoring the one-sided nature of the contest.

Rocky Flintoff's fifty and Dhariwal's all-round show shape County clash

Rocky Flintoff marked a personal milestone with his maiden first-class fifty, helping Lancashire stay competitive in their County Championship fixture. However, Gloucestershire kept the upper hand thanks to a half-century from Kamran Dhariwal, who also contributed with the ball. James Langridge chipped in with two wickets to further tighten Gloucestershire's grip on the match. Lancashire face an uphill task as Gloucestershire remain firmly on course for victory.

Surrey batters steady ship with fifties as draw beckons against Sussex

Surrey's Ryan Patel, Ben Foakes, and Mahipal Lomror each scored half-centuries to give their side some stability in their County Championship match against Sussex at Hove. The innings from the three batters provided the visitors with crucial breathing space during a difficult period. Play took place under gloomy conditions at the Hove ground. With the match situation and weather combining to limit progress, a draw appeared the most likely outcome as proceedings continued.
